Types of Ovens
When searching for an oven, particularly around sales events, it's necessary to know which type suits your cooking design and kitchen layout. Below are the most typical types of ovens on the marketplace:
Oven TypeDescriptionPerfect ForConventional OvensThese ovens use either gas or electric heating aspects for cooking.General baking and cooking.Convection OvensGeared up with a fan that circulates hot air for even cooking.Baking numerous trays all at once.Wall OvensInstalled in the wall, releasing up area in the kitchen counters.Little kitchen areas with restricted space.Double OvensInclude 2 different oven cavities, permitting multi-tasking.Large households or those who amuse often.Range OvensCombines a cooktop and an oven in one unit.Those requiring both stovetop and oven.Portable OvensSmaller, frequently electric, ovens suitable for minimal areas or outdoors.Dorms, little homes, or outdoor camping.Key Features to Consider
When looking for an oven on sale, certain functions can considerably affect your cooking experience. Buyers should prioritize the following:

Size: Ensure the oven fits your kitchen area. Step the area where the oven will be set up before purchasing.

Fuel Type: Decide in between gas and electric. Gas ovens provide accurate temperature control, while electric ovens tend to be more consistent in baking.

Self-Cleaning: Self-cleaning ovens save time and effort in maintaining tidiness, a necessary feature for busy homes.

Smart Features: Modern ovens might include Wi-Fi connectivity, enabling you to manage your oven from another location, adjust settings, and get alerts.

Temperature Range: Consider the versatility of temperature level settings. High-end models frequently provide a wider variety of temperatures for different cooking styles.

Additional Cooking Modes: Some ovens feature specialized modes like steam, broil, and air fry, supplying adaptability in cooking techniques.

How do I understand if the oven is energy-efficient?
Energy Star-rated ovens generally signify much better energy effectiveness. Look for the Energy Guide label on the device, which provides annual energy intake data.
